    What is the most important part of a microwave oven?

    The waveguide is a component of the microwave that guides the microwaves through the food while also not allowing them to escape, which is an important safety feature. The waveguide is a hollow metal tube that transmits and directs the waves produced by the magnetron towards the cooking cavity

    Can you put a regular microwave in a cabinet?

    A microwave oven, designed exclusively for a kitchen countertop, has vents that are built into the back of the microwave. If installed into a cabinet, these vents will be blocked and unable to release steam from the microwave. Talk about a fire hazard for your kitchen.

    What is the minimum distance from stove to microwave oven?

    If your microwave is installed above the range, the manufacturer will recommend that you keep a distance of at least thirteen inches between the base of the microwave and the top of the stove. But some manufacturers might call for this distance to be a minimum of eighteen inches.

    Can I put a freestanding microwave oven in a cupboard?

    It is safe to place a freestanding microwave oven in a cupboard as long as you have checked the microwave ovens space requirements with the manufacturer. Microwave ovens need a certain amount of space around themselves to ensure proper ventilation and that nothing in your cupboard ends up catching fire.
